aloe vera [ˈæləʊ ˈvɪərə] n
1. (Life Sciences & Allied Applications / Plants) a juice obtained from the leaves of a liliaceous plant, Aloe vera, used as an emollient in skin and hair preparations 2. the juice of this plant, used in skin and hair preparations ThesaurusLegend: Synonyms Related Words Antonyms
